Dr. Kenna Wilkie is dedicated to helping people move better, recover faster, and feel their best. She specializes in sports medicine, orthopedic acupuncture, and chronic pain. Blending the wisdom of Traditional Chinese Medicine with modern anatomy and physiology to deliver intentional, results-driven care.

Before pursuing a career in acupuncture, Dr. Kenna earned her Bachelor of Science from the University of Wisconsin–Madison, where she competed as a Division I athlete on the Women’s Varsity Rowing Team. Her experience as a collegiate athlete shaped her understanding of physical resilience, mental grit, and the importance of recovery in sustaining performance - values that now guide her work with every patient.

At Pursuit, Dr. Kenna’s mission is to help people view acupuncture not as a last resort, but as an essential part of their training and recovery plan. Her treatments empower athletes and active individuals to prevent injury, enhance performance, and cultivate long-term balance and wellness.

Education

Doctorate of Acupuncture with a Chinese Herbal Medicine Specialization (DAcCHM), Northwestern Health Sciences University

Master’s of Acupuncture (M.Ac), Northwestern Health Sciences University

Baccalaureate of Science in Human Development & Family Studies, University of Wisconsin Madison

Licensures & Certificates

Licensed Acupuncturist (L.Ac.) WI NO. 2096-55, State of Wisconsin

Diplomate of Acupuncture (Dipl. Ac.), National Certification Commission for Acupuncture and Oriental Medicine (NCCAOM)

Clean Needle Technique Certified, Council of Colleges of Acupuncture and Oriental Medicine (CCAOM)

Basic Life Support Provider (CPR & AED), American Red Cross renewal

Reiki Level 1 & 2, Usui Skiki Ryoho
